What is a rack-mounted energy storage battery? Space revolution in energy systems

The rack-mounted energy storage battery adopts the industrial standardized 19-inch cabinet design (depth 280-720mm), and realizes elastic capacity expansion through modular battery cell stacking. In the field of energy storage, it solves three core pain points:

  • Space efficiency: vertical stacking saves 70% of the floor space compared with traditional energy storage cabinets (TK -7999.92cm inch 480 × 482 × 135mm, only the size of mini refrigerator).

Deep Analysis of Family Scene Requirements

Basic configuration: TKS-500(5.12KWH) matching 80 ㎡ apartment:
■ Air conditioner 1.5 pcs (1.2KW) × 8 hours = 9.6KWH
■ Refrigerator 0.15KW × 24 hours = 3.6KWH
■ Remaining 42% power redundancy
High-level scheme: TKS-1600(16KWH)+ photovoltaic direct connection to realize villa energy autonomy
